What is the difference between Grading Excavation vs Trenching Excavation?

AspectGrading ExcavationTrenching Excavation
PurposeLeveling and shaping land surfaces for construction or landscapingCreating narrow, deep channels for utilities or drainage
Work EnvironmentOpen areas, large-scale land modificationNarrow, deep trenches often near structures or roads
Required CertificationsHeavy equipment operation, site safetyHeavy equipment operation, trench safety (e.g., OSHA trenching standards)
Common UsageSite preparation, grading for foundationsUtility installation, drainage systems

While both grading excavation and trenching excavation involve earthmoving with heavy equipment, grading focuses on surface leveling and shaping large areas, whereas trenching involves digging narrow, deep channels for utilities or drainage. Understanding these differences helps in selecting the right specialist for your construction project.

Job Responsibilities/ Qualifications:

·         Oversee all on-site grading and earthwork activities
·         Operate heavy equipment including bulldozers, motor graders, excavators, loaders, scrapers and compactors
·         Ability to grade stakes and grade set
·         Knowledge of grading, excavation, cut and fill, compaction, drainage and site preparation
·         Ability to read, understand and interpret blueprints, construction drawings, specifications and soil reports.
·         Knowledge of safety regulations and protocol
  • Enforce OSHA safety standards and ensure all team members adhere to safety protocols on-site. 
·         Strong leadership skills with the ability to manage and motivate a crew while providing a safe and productive work environment
·         Time management skills with the ability to manage job deadlines as well as employees’ hours.
·         Organization skills to schedule and manage daily activities
·         Ability to stand for long period of time, walk on uneven terrain, climb on/off equipment, lift as well
·         Maintain equipment daily, such as greasing etc.
·         Willingness to work in all weather conditions, including extreme heat and cold.
·         Ability to effectively communicate.  Be able to coordinate with project managers, engineers, subcontractors, vendors, inspectors, local officials, and employees.
·         Ability and knowledge of DIR jobs and paperwork
